Your Committee on Water, Land, and Housing, to which was referred S.B. No. 2375, S.D. 1, entitled:
"A BILL FOR AN ACT RELATING TO AGRICULTURAL-BASED COMMERCIAL OPERATIONS,"
begs leave to report as follows:
The purpose and intent of this measure is to allow agricultural-based commercial operations in agricultural districts and to include agricultural-based commercial operations under the definition of "farming operation" in chapter 165, Hawaii Revised Statutes, the Hawaii Right to Farm Act.
Your Committee received testimony in support of this measure from the Department of Agriculture, Hawaii Farm Bureau Federation, Kamehameha Schools, and Kahuku Farms. Your Committee received testimony in opposition to this measure from the City and County of Honolulu Department of Planning and Permitting.
Your Committee finds that existing laws do not permit agricultural-based commercial operations in agricultural districts. This restriction increases permitting requirements, limits farmers' economic opportunities, and places farmers at a disadvantage with neighboring landowners. By allowing agricultural-based commercial operations in agricultural districts, this measure will improve and diversify farmers' economic opportunities.
Your Committee has amended this measure by:
(1) Specifying that the allowed agricultural-based commercial operations be producer-operated;
(2) Including the sale of logo items related to a producer's agricultural operations and other food items as an agricultural-based commercial operation;
(3) Including the preparation and sale of certain food by producer-operated retail food establishments as an agricultural-based commercial operation; and
(4) Making technical, nonsubstantive amendments for the purposes of clarity and consistency.
As affirmed by the record of votes of the members of your Committee on Water, Land, and Housing that is attached to this report, your Committee is in accord with the intent and purpose of S.B. No. 2375, S.D. 1, as amended herein, and recommends that it pass Third Reading in the form attached hereto as S.B. No. 2375, S.D. 2.
